Dr. Will Cole has been eating kale and drinking health tonics since long before it was trendy on Instagram. The functional medicine practitioner and man behind the Ketotarian diet, has long understood the power of food as medicine and now works with patients from all over the world. His approach to wellness is simple: meet everyone where the are at.

Nutritionist Amy Shapiro has wellness in her genes. Her dad was in the health food industry since before she was born and her family owned a health food store while she was growing up. She quickly realized the healing power of food and always finished her veggies at dinner — but she didn’t pursue a career in the industry until later. After eight years in the corporate world, Shapiro went back to school to get her Masters and Clinical Nutrition and went on to start Real Nutrition, where she creates personalized nutrition programs for a wide range of clients.

Krystal Weisberg is not your average fitness pro. The former New York City club and nightlife marketer didn’t work out for the first time until she was 28. Yoga was Weisberg's ah-ha moment and she used it to make a space for herself in the wellness community. After helping other fitness studios with their marketing needs, she started teaching classes and running a fitness studio herself. (She's also Bobbi Brown's new personal trainer!)

Danielle Diamond got into yoga long before there was a studio on every NYC block. While working at MTV as a producer, she incorporated yoga into a video and fell in love with the practice. She turned to it as a way to cope, get focused and stay grounded and she hasn’t looked back. Today, Diamond is a certified yoga instructor and nutrition coach, working with clients to help them master a handstand and swap their morning bagel for a smoothie bowl.
